Follow-up: John Lewis experiencing Growth due to Olympic Games
from Euromonitor Podcasts · host Euromonitor International
In his recent videocast, Lamine Lahouasnia, retailing analyst at Euromonitor, stated retailer John Lewis would be the 'gold medal' winner in terms of sales. John Lewis has recently released sales data for the first week of the games, and the department store has seen 22% sales growth during that period. Other retailers in London have not been so lucky - many tourists are avoiding the town all together in fear of high traffic and congestion.
